The first and most important question we need to tackle is: how can paper possibly be strong? The secret lies in moving beyond the image of a flat sheet and thinking in three dimensions. The core of our furniture isn't flimsy cardboard; it's made of high-strength, densely wound paper tubes. Think about the basic principles of architecture. A single sheet of paper is weak, but roll it into a tube, and it can suddenly support many times its own weight. This is the same principle that allows ancient columns to hold up massive stone roofs.
Our engineers have spent years perfecting the composition and density of these paper tubes. They are not hollow, fragile shells. They are solid, robust structural elements designed to withstand the pressures of daily life. When you place a heavy stack of books, your laptop, a ceramic lamp, and a cup of coffee on our Paper End table , you're not trusting a flimsy material. You're trusting a meticulously engineered system.
But the tubes are only part of the equation. The real magic happens when they connect. We've developed a system of versatile, multi-directional connectors (3-way, 4-way, and 5-way). These connectors act like the joints in a skeleton. They don't just hold the tubes together; they distribute weight and stress evenly across the entire structure. This modular grid system turns individual components into a single, unified, and remarkably sturdy unit. The result is furniture that boasts a high load-bearing capacity, easily rivaling many traditional alternatives, while weighing a fraction of the amount.
The second biggest concern after strength is, of course, water. We live in the real world, where spills happen and humidity is a fact of life. We've addressed this head-on. The surface of our paper tubes is treated with a protective coating that makes it water-resistant. A quick wipe-down of a spill won't cause the material to weaken or bubble. Furthermore, every piece of our furniture comes with specially designed plastic foot covers. These feet serve a crucial purpose: they elevate the paper structure off the ground, creating a barrier against ground-level moisture and making it safe to clean your floors without worry. While we recommend maintaining an indoor humidity level below 60% for optimal longevity—a standard recommendation for preserving many home goods, including books and electronics—our furniture is built to handle the realities of a modern home.
Think of it this way: Our paper furniture is like a high-performance raincoat. It's designed to protect you from the elements and keep you dry, but you probably wouldn't go swimming in it. It's engineered for its intended environment, and in a home setting, it excels.
